服务器性能飞跃:内核调优与升级实战
|
作为主机运维者,我们每天面对的挑战之一就是如何让服务器性能达到最佳状态。随着业务增长和系统负载的变化,单纯的硬件升级已无法满足需求,内核调优与版本升级成为关键手段。
AI绘图结果,仅供参考 内核是操作系统的核心,其配置直接影响到系统的响应速度、资源分配和稳定性。通过调整内核参数,我们可以优化网络栈、文件系统行为以及进程调度策略,从而提升整体性能。在实际操作中,我们需要关注几个关键参数,比如net.ipv4.tcp_tw_reuse、vm.swappiness和sched_migration_cost。这些参数的合理设置能够减少延迟、提高吞吐量,并降低系统抖动。 升级内核时,不能只看版本号的跳跃,更要评估新版本带来的改进是否适用于当前环境。例如,Linux 5.10之后的版本引入了多项I/O调度器优化,对高并发场景有显著提升。 测试是验证调优效果的重要环节。我们通常使用基准测试工具如sysbench、fio或iperf来对比调优前后的性能差异,确保每一步改动都带来实质性的提升。 保持内核补丁的及时更新也是运维工作的重点。安全漏洞和性能缺陷往往会在新版本中得到修复,及时升级能有效避免潜在风险。 在实战过程中,建议先在测试环境中验证调优方案,再逐步推广到生产环境。同时,建立完善的监控体系,实时跟踪CPU、内存、磁盘和网络的使用情况,为后续优化提供数据支持。 最终,内核调优与升级不是一蹴而就的事情,而是持续优化的过程。只有不断学习、实践和调整,才能真正实现服务器性能的飞跃。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

